Make a deposit

Whether you are just starting out or you are a seasoned poker player, it is important to know how to make a deposit when playing online poker. Poker sites offer a wide variety of deposit methods, including credit and debit cards, prepaid cards, electronic wallets, cryptocurrencies, vouchers, and checks. The most popular deposit methods are credit and debit cards, prepaid cards, and electronic wallets.

Creating an online poker account is simple, and funding your account is also easy. Some sites require you to download software and complete a KYC (Know Your Customer) process. You may be asked to provide proof of address, such as a bank statement, or a driver’s license.

Most online poker rooms offer a wide variety of deposit methods, which include credit and debit cards, prepaid cards, vouchers, cryptocurrencies, and checks. Some sites also offer PayPal. Using PayPal is a fast and secure way to transfer money to and from poker sites. Unlike credit and debit cards, PayPal does not require you to send your bank details.

Track your results

Using the right software can help you track your results while improving your gameplay. It can also help you find a group of like-minded poker fans, which can be helpful for networking. In addition, the software can help you eliminate leaks, a problem that can eat away at your bankroll.

Using the right software can help you track the results of a single hand, or even your entire poker session. There are many different tools out there, but the top contenders are PokerTracker 4 and RunGood. If you don’t want to shell out the money for a software subscription, you can always track your results manually. This is the simplest way to keep track of your game.

PokerTracker 4 provides a plethora of tracking tools, and the interactive tracking results are highly useful. They can show you everything from how much money you’ve lost or won in a hand to detailed information on your opponents. The software also allows you to create your own custom reports. Its leak tracker is known as the best in the business.

Learn the game

Whether you’re an avid poker player or a beginner, you can learn the game of online poker. But before you go to the casino and play for real money, you need to make sure you understand the rules of the game.

Poker is a card game played with a standard deck of 52 cards. Players use the two cards they’re dealt and the five community cards to create their hand. The goal is to make the best hand.

The most popular variant of poker is Texas Hold’em. It is played with two to eight players on a single table. There are also several other variants, including Omaha, Omaha Hi-Lo, Stud, and Draw poker.

If you’re new to poker, you should start by learning the rules of the game and memorizing the poker hand rankings. Once you’ve gotten the hang of it, you can easily read a poker chart and pick out the winning hands. You can also find free poker games to practice on.
